Ideal \I*de"al\, n.
A mental conception regarded as a standard of perfection; a
model of excellence, beauty, etc.
[1913 Webster]

The ideal is to be attained by selecting and assembling
in one whole the beauties and perfections which are
usually seen in different individuals, excluding
everything defective or unseemly, so as to form a type
or model of the species. Thus, the Apollo Belvedere is
the ideal of the beauty and proportion of the human
frame. --Fleming.
[1913 Webster]

Ideal \I*de"al\, a. [L. idealis: cf. F. id['e]al.]

1. Existing in idea or thought; conceptional; intellectual;
mental; as, ideal knowledge.
[1913 Webster]


2. Reaching an imaginary standard of excellence; fit for a
model; faultless; as, ideal beauty. --Byron.
[1913 Webster]

There will always be a wide interval between
practical and ideal excellence. --Rambler.
[1913 Webster]


3. Existing in fancy or imagination only; visionary; unreal.
"Planning ideal common wealth." --Southey.
[1913 Webster]


4. Teaching the doctrine of idealism; as, the ideal theory or
philosophy.
[1913 Webster]


5. (Math.) Imaginary.

Syn: Intellectual; mental; visionary; fanciful; imaginary;
unreal; impracticable; utopian.
[1913 Webster]

ideal
adj 1: conforming to an ultimate standard of perfection or
excellence; embodying an ideal

2: constituting or existing only in the form of an idea or
mental image or conception; "a poem or essay may be typical
of its period in idea or ideal content"

3: of or relating to the philosophical doctrine of the reality
of ideas [syn: ideal, idealistic]
n 1: the idea of something that is perfect; something that one
hopes to attain

2: model of excellence or perfection of a kind; one having no
equal [syn: ideal, paragon, nonpareil, saint,
apotheosis, nonesuch, nonsuch]

IDEAL


1. Ideal DEductive Applicative Language. A language by Pier
Bosco and Elio Giovannetti combining Miranda and Prolog.
Function definitions can have a guard condition (introduced
by ":-") which is a conjunction of equalities between
arbitrary terms, including functions. These guards are solved
by normal Prolog resolution and unification. It was
originally compiled into C-Prolog but was eventually to be
compiled to K-leaf.


2. A numerical constraint language written by Van Wyk of
Stanford in 1980 for typesetting graphics in documents.
It was inspired partly by Metafont and is distributed as
part of Troff.

["A High-Level Language for Specifying Pictures", C.J. Van
Wyk, ACM Trans Graphics 1(2):163-182 (Apr 1982)].

(1994-12-15)

ideal

In domain theory, a non-empty, downward closed
subset which is also closed under binary least upper bounds.
I.e. anything less than an element is also an element and the
least upper bound of any two elements is also an element.

(1997-09-26)
